Several variations exist within the realm of the Rolex Daytona white gold diamond dial. Understanding these nuances is crucial to appreciating the breadth of this collection and the factors influencing their respective values.

Rolex Daytona 18k White Gold: This broad category encompasses several models, each distinguished by subtle variations in the dial, bezel, and bracelet. The common thread is the use of 18k white gold for the case and bracelet, providing exceptional durability and a luxurious weight. The diamond-set dials can vary in the number and arrangement of diamonds, contributing to the unique character of each piece. Some models might feature baguette-cut diamonds, others round brilliant-cut, and the density of the diamonds can also differ significantly.

Rolex Daytona Oysterflex White Gold: A relatively recent addition to the Daytona family, the Oysterflex bracelet offers a contemporary twist on the classic design. The Oysterflex bracelet, made of a high-performance elastomer, provides exceptional comfort and flexibility, while maintaining the robustness expected of a Rolex. The combination of the luxurious white gold case and the sporty Oysterflex bracelet creates a unique aesthetic, appealing to those who appreciate both luxury and a more casual, versatile style. Diamond-set dials further enhance the already striking appearance of these models.

Rolex Daytona Meteorite White Gold: For those seeking an even more exclusive timepiece, the meteorite dial Daytona offers an extraordinary level of rarity and visual interest. Meteorite dials are crafted from fragments of meteorites, showcasing the unique Widmanstätten patterns formed during the meteorite's formation billions of years ago. The combination of the shimmering meteorite dial and the gleaming white gold case is breathtaking, resulting in a truly unique and highly collectible piece. Adding diamonds to this already exceptional base further elevates its status and desirability.
